Subject: Flaky DNS resolution on the Quillhaven staging pool

Hey Marta,

Quick heads-up before you cut the release: we've been seeing intermittent DNS resolution failures on the Quillhaven staging pool since last night. Roughly one in twenty lookups for the internal resolver times out, then retries fine, so the smoke tests pass on rerun but it's noisy. Devlin suspects the resolver cache on the newer nodes; he's rotating them now. I'd hold the tag until we confirm. The trace token from the failing run is right below this.

pipeline stamp: htk4_ae36

## Authentication

Upgrading Brindlepost broker from v4 to v5 changes auth. Plaintext credentials are gone; all clients must present bearer tokens to the Halverton gateway before opening a channel. Migration script `migrate_auth.sh` rewrites client configs in place — review its diff carefully, it touches every consumer. Token TTL defaults to 12 hours; refresh is client-side. Reject any PR reintroducing static passwords. For local verification against the staging broker, authenticate with the bearer token below.

session JWT of hahif-fawif = eyJhbGciOiJIUzI1NiIsInR5cCI6IkpXVCJ9.eyJzdWIiOiI04_V2KayaDIn0.-jKHPhS5t5LS

## Account Recovery — FabriKit Plugin Authors

If your FabriKit sandbox account locks after failed seed-generation runs, do not re-register. Locked accounts keep their fixture quotas; new ones don't.

Steps:
1. Run `fabrikit auth reset --sandbox`.
2. Wait for the cooldown timer (5 min).
3. Confirm the lock flag cleared in the plugin console.

If the flag persists, escalate to the Fixture Ops rotation. At the recovery prompt, enter the passphrase below.

vault phrase of tajop-haduf = holath-brivan-wenax